The enchantment of those edits lies of their skill to mix intricate mathematical concepts with the concise and charming format of TikTok.The Residue Theorem, a cornerstone of complicated evaluation, supplies a strong methodology for evaluating complicated integrals.
Primarily, it permits us to calculate the integral of a operate round a closed contour by contemplating the values of the operate at its singularities (factors the place the operate is undefined or behaves unusually). Visualizing Advanced Numbers
Understanding the interaction of actual and imaginary parts of complicated numbers is significant. Representing these numbers on the complicated aircraft, utilizing a colour gradient to indicate magnitude, will help viewers visualize the intricate motion of complicated numbers throughout integration. A dynamic animation showcasing the motion of those numbers alongside a contour path can additional elucidate the theory’s essence.
For instance, the true half could possibly be represented by the x-axis and the imaginary half by the y-axis. Completely different colours may signify numerous magnitudes, and a transferring level may hint the contour path, showcasing the evolution of the complicated numbers.
Illustrating Contour Integrals
Contour integrals, on the coronary heart of the Residue Theorem, may be visualized utilizing animated paths. Utilizing totally different colours to spotlight the trail and the corresponding complicated numbers alongside the trail, viewers can perceive the mixing course of extra intuitively. A path traced by a vibrant line, overlaid with smaller animations of the operate’s values at every level, creates a visually wealthy illustration.
Illustrate how the trail is deformed utilizing animated transitions, showcasing the invariance of the integral underneath such transformations. Think about using a gradient to signify the operate’s worth at every level alongside the contour.
Demonstrating the Function of Residues
The idea of residues may be successfully visualized utilizing totally different styles and sizes for poles. A round animation round a pole, accompanied by an animated progress of the residue worth, can make clear the significance of residues in calculating the contour integral. Representing residues with totally different colours or sizes can successfully emphasize their contribution to the ultimate consequence. Animate the poles and the corresponding residues on the complicated aircraft as the mixing path approaches them, making the connection between residues and the integral extra obvious.
